Az automatizálás ereje: Az Excel-makrók .netre konvertálása


Az Excel-makrók olyan hatékony eszközök, amelyek lehetővé teszik a felhasználók számára az ismétlődő feladatok automatizálását, a munkafolyamatok racionalizálását és a hatékonyság növelését. A vállalkozások növekedésével és a technológia fejlődésével azonban egyre nyilvánvalóbbá válnak az Excel-makrók korlátai. Itt jön a képbe a .Net – egy erőteljes és sokoldalú keretrendszer, amely lehetővé teszi az összetettebb automatizálást és a más rendszerekkel való integrációt. Ebben a cikkben az Excel-makrók .Netre való konvertálásának folyamatát és az ezzel járó előnyöket vizsgáljuk meg a szervezet számára.

1. lépés: A makrók értékelése

Az átalakítási folyamat első lépése a meglévő Excel-makrók értékelése. Mérlegelje, hogy mely makrók kritikusak az üzleti folyamatok szempontjából, és melyeket lehet nyugdíjazni vagy lecserélni. Ez az értékelés segít meghatározni, hogy mely makrókat kell átalakítani, és melyeket lehet úgy hagyni, ahogy vannak.

2. lépés: Tervezze meg az átalakítási stratégiát

Ezután meg kell terveznie az átalakítási stratégiát. Ez magában foglalja az igényeinek leginkább megfelelő .Net keretrendszer és eszközök azonosítását. Azt is el kell döntenie, hogy a makrókat házon belül konvertálja-e, vagy kiszervezi a munkát egy külső szolgáltatónak.

3. lépés: A makrók konvertálása

Miután megtervezte a konverziós stratégiát, itt az ideje, hogy megkezdje a tényleges konverziós folyamatot. Ez magában foglalja a makrók .Net kódba történő átírását. Míg egyes makrók elég egyszerűek lehetnek a kézi konverzióhoz, az összetettebb makrók speciális konverziós eszközök használatát igényelhetik.

4. lépés: Tesztelés és finomítás

Miután a makrókat .Net-re konvertálta, fontos, hogy alaposan tesztelje őket. Ez segít azonosítani az esetleges hibákat vagy problémákat, amelyeket még az új rendszer telepítése előtt meg kell oldani. Miután azonosította a problémákat, finomíthatja a kódot, és addig tesztelheti újra, amíg meg nem bizonyosodik arról, hogy az új rendszer a kívánt módon működik.

Az Excel-makrók .netre való átalakításának előnyei

Az Excel-makrók .netre való átalakítása számos előnnyel járhat a szervezet számára. A .Net például összetettebb automatizálást tesz lehetővé, ami segíthet a munkafolyamatok racionalizálásában és a termelékenység javításában. A .Net emellett integrálható más rendszerekkel, például adatbázisokkal és webes szolgáltatásokkal, így nagyobb teljesítményű és sokoldalúbb automatizálási megoldásokat hozhat létre.

Következtetés

Az Excel-makrók hatékony eszközök, de ahogy a vállalkozások növekednek és a technológia fejlődik, fontos a fejlettebb automatizálási megoldások felfedezése. Az Excel-makrók .Net-re történő átalakítása segíthet a nagyobb hatékonyság elérésében, a munkafolyamatok racionalizálásában és más rendszerekkel való integrálásában. Az ebben a cikkben ismertetett lépéseket követve sikeresen konvertálhatja makróit .Net-re, és emelheti automatizálását a következő szintre.

FAQ
Hogyan lehet a VBA-t VB netre konvertálni?

A VBA (Visual Basic for Applications) kód VB (Visual Basic for Applications) .NET kóddá történő átalakítása kissé trükkös lehet, de számos lépést megtehet, hogy a folyamat zökkenőmentesebbé váljon.

1. Értse meg a VBA és a VB .NET közötti különbségeket: A VBA VB .NET-re való átalakításának első lépése a két programozási nyelv közötti különbségek megértése. A VBA a Visual Basic egy részhalmaza, és elsősorban a Microsoft Office alkalmazásokban végzett feladatok automatizálására szolgál. A VB .NET ezzel szemben egy teljes értékű programozási nyelv, amely önálló alkalmazások létrehozására használható.

2. Használjon kódkonvertáló eszközt: Számos online kódkonvertáló eszköz áll rendelkezésre, amelyek segítségével a VBA kódot VB .NET-re konvertálhatja. Ezek az eszközök automatizált és kézi módszerek kombinációját használják a kód átalakításához, de nem mindig adnak pontos eredményt.

3. Írja át a kódot kézzel: Ha nagyobb ellenőrzést szeretne az átalakítási folyamat felett, előfordulhat, hogy a VBA-kódot kézzel kell átírnia VB .NET-re. Ehhez meg kell értenie a VB .NET szintaxisát és szerkezetét, és el kell végeznie a szükséges változtatásokat a VBA-kódon.

4. Tesztelje a kódot: Miután a VBA kódot átkonvertálta VB .NET-re, alaposan tesztelnie kell, hogy megbizonyosodjon arról, hogy az elvárásoknak megfelelően működik. Ez magában foglalja a kód futtatását és a hibák ellenőrzését, a felmerülő problémák elhárítását, valamint a szükséges változtatások elvégzését.

Összefoglalva, a VBA VB .NET-re történő átalakítása mindkét programozási nyelv jó ismeretét, a kódkonvertáló eszközök használatát, kézi átírást és alapos tesztelést igényel.

Hogyan lehet Excel-makrót Visual Basicre konvertálni?

Egy Excel-makró átalakítása Visual Basic (VB) nyelvre néhány lépésből áll. Íme egy részletes válasz:

1. lépés: Nyissa meg a makrót tartalmazó Excel-munkafüzetet

Indítsa el a Microsoft Excel programot, és nyissa meg a VB-be konvertálni kívánt makrót tartalmazó munkafüzetet.

2. lépés: Nyissa meg a Visual Basic szerkesztőt

Kattintson a „Fejlesztő” fülre, majd a „Visual Basic” gombra a Visual Basic szerkesztő megnyitásához. Alternatívaként használhatja az ‘Alt + F11’ billentyűkombinációt is a Visual Basic szerkesztő megnyitásához.

3. lépés: A VBA kód másolása

A Visual Basic szerkesztőben keresse meg a ‘Project Explorer’ ablakban a konvertálni kívánt makrót. Kattintson duplán a makrót tartalmazó modulra, és másolja ki a teljes VBA-kódot.

4. lépés: Új VB projekt létrehozása

Nyisson meg egy új példányt a Microsoft Visual Studio programból, és hozzon létre egy új VB projektet. Ehhez kattintson a ‘Fájl’ gombra, majd válassza az ‘Új projekt’ lehetőséget. Válassza a ‘Windows Forms App (.NET Framework)’ projekt típust, és adjon neki nevet.

5. lépés: A kódszerkesztő megnyitása

Miután létrehozta az új projektet, nyissa meg a kódszerkesztőt a Solution Explorer ablakban az űrlapra duplán kattintva.

6. lépés: A VBA-kód beillesztése

Illessze be a kódszerkesztőbe a korábban lemásolt VBA-kódot. Előfordulhat azonban, hogy a kód egyes részeit módosítani kell ahhoz, hogy a VB-ben működjön. Például előfordulhat, hogy az Excel-specifikus objektumokat és metódusokat le kell cserélnie a VB megfelelőikre.

7. lépés: A VB-projekt mentése és futtatása

Miután elvégezte a szükséges módosításokat, mentse el a VB-projektet, és futtassa azt, hogy tesztelje, működik-e a várt módon. Az átalakítás során esetlegesen felmerülő hibák elhárítására is szükség lehet.

Összefoglalva, egy Excel makró VB-be történő konvertálása magában foglalja a VBA kód másolását, egy új VB projekt létrehozását, a kód beillesztését a kódszerkesztőbe, a módosítások elvégzését és a VB projekt tesztelését.